Expert Review

The Security Officer - Patrol Guard position at Allied Universal provides a stable entry-level opportunity in the security sector. With a starting pay of $18.00 per hour, this role is designed for those who value community service and safety. Patrol duties involve maintaining a visible presence to deter incidents, ensuring a safe environment for clients in various sectors, including tech and media.

While the benefits package includes medical, dental, vision, and a retirement savings plan, the starting salary may be a drawback for some. The job is physically demanding, requiring long hours on your feet and the ability to handle stressful situations effectively. Shifts may include weekends and holidays, which could impact work-life balance.

Our team found that this role primarily suits individuals looking for stability and a sense of purpose in their work. If you're aiming for rapid career advancement or higher pay, this position may not meet those expectations.
